Understanding a CPS Test


A CPS test captures all valid clicks inside a designated testing area during a set time period. Once the timer stops, the system determines the average clicks per second. For example, 50 clicks over ten seconds equals five CPS. The calculation is straightforward, but the activity can reveal useful information about speed, focus and control of the hand. The test typically begins on the first click, which helps the user begin instantly. A display counter can indicate the click count and the remaining duration. After the session concludes, the score is displayed right away. People can then retake the test to check if their speed is getting better.

Widely Used Clicking Methods


The basic clicking uses a single finger to click the main mouse button continuously. This technique is easy to learn and ideal for general use. Maintaining a comfortable grip and stable speed can improve consistency without placing unnecessary pressure on the wrist. Jitter clicking relies on rapid shaking movements in the hand or forearm to create high-speed clicking. It may produce faster results, but it can also result in discomfort over time. Participants should stop if pain occurs, any discomfort. Butterfly clicking involves alternating two fingers on the primary button. The alternating movement may increase speed because one finger clicks while the other resets. Performance depends greatly on the mouse design and the participant’s coordination. Some devices may detect clicks differently, so results can change. Drag clicking requires dragging a finger along the button surface in a way that generates multiple clicks. This method depends on the right mouse and careful control. It is not supported equally by every mouse, and too much pressure can harm the mouse. For general practice, simple techniques are usually better.

Touchscreen Tap Per Second Testing


A TPS test measures how many screen taps a person can complete during a selected time. It follows the same basic calculation, but the interaction happens directly on a touchscreen. The participant repeatedly taps the active area until the timer reaches zero. Touchscreen results may differ from mouse results because tapping involves different finger movements and device response times. Screen size, touch sensitivity, protective glass and finger placement can all affect performance. Keeping the device stable on a flat surface may increase consistency. Some participants tap with a single finger, while others use two fingers alternately for faster tapping. A regular tapping is more effective than aggressive tapping. Pressing too hard won’t improve results and may lead to discomfort. Light, controlled contact allows the finger to move quickly while avoiding discomfort.

Factors That Can Affect Test Results


Mouse quality, button resistance and device response can influence click speed. A tight button slows clicks, while a responsive button detects clicks easily. Touchscreen tests can be affected by display responsiveness, running apps and the screen quality. Test duration also changes the nature of the result. Very short sessions focus on rapid clicking, whereas longer sessions measure stamina. External factors like fatigue and environment may affect performance as well. For fair comparisons, users should maintain consistent conditions and run repeated tests.
